  • Patent number: 10296323
    Abstract: A system and method for deploying user apps to user devices is disclosed. A service module on a host system maintains class files of the user app within an original archive, and creates an install agent archive and a modified user app archive from the original archive. In some embodiments, the service module deploys an install agent from the install agent archive and a runtime agent of the modified user app archive to the user device. In other embodiments, the install agent and the runtime agent are pre-installed within a virtual machine of the user device. The install agent receives the class files from the service module, and the runtime agent loads and executes the class files to deploy the user app on the user device. In a preferred embodiment, the system enables faster initial deployment and redeployment of user apps on Android user devices than current systems and methods.

  • Patent number: 10268476
    Abstract: A system and method for fast restart of user apps on a user device. A host system hosts classes and resources of the user app, and a service app host application on the host system deploys an initial instance of the user app on the user device that includes additional instrumentation for enabling the user app to be quickly restarted on the user device with a set of changed classes and/or changed resources that comprise the latest version of the user app during development of the user app. This can significantly reduce the typically long turnaround time when developing and testing user apps as compared to current systems and methods. In a preferred embodiment, the system enables a fast restart of user apps running on Android user devices.

  • Patent number: 9183550
    Abstract: System and method to enable and facilitate purchases through mobile communications on mobile devices, smartphones, feature phones, tablet computers, etc by allowing the user to interact with native interface and/or by eliminating the need of entering the MSISDN identifier by the user. MSISDN value is required to identify mobile subscriber and request a mobile billing transaction through carrier's infrastructure. A system comprises at least one data computing facility, which is connected to mobile carrier billing, short code and networking infrastructure and a plurality of converters to communicate and interface with a plurality of controllers for various mobile device types and platforms.

  • Patent number: 8843161
    Abstract: System and method to facilitate purchases through mobile communications on various types of mobile devices and platforms by reducing the number of steps it takes the user to complete the purchase with mobile in-app payments, and/or by enabling purchases to be made without the device being connected to the Internet and/or by automatic compilation of payment request. A set of user identifying details, including user's country, mobile carrier name and phone number, is required in order to process a mobile purchase. The advantages of the present invention from the user perspective is the ability to complete the purchase in fewer steps by automatic user details identification and the ability to complete the purchase in case there is no Internet connection by embedding a specially formatted database file with the application of mobile device.
